Moldova to get $570 million in IMF loans (Russian Information Agency Novosti)
The International Monetary Fund (IMF) will provide Moldova with loans worth a total of $570 million to help one of Europe’s poorest states in post-crisis recovery.

USDA home loans available (Jacksonville Daily News)
United States Department of Agriculture Rural Development Home Loans are now available to low income applicants through the Section 502 Home Loan Program in Onslow County outside of the municipal limits of Jacksonville.
